Understanding the Differences Between Single and Multi-layer Steel Head Gaskets

Head gaskets are vital components in internal combustion engines, ensuring a tight seal between the engine block and cylinder head. They prevent leaks of coolant, oil, and combustion gases, maintaining engine efficiency and preventing damage. Among various types of head gaskets, single-layer steel (SLS) and multi-layer steel (MLS) gaskets are the most common. Understanding their differences helps in selecting the right gasket for specific engine needs.

What Is a Single-Layer Steel (SLS) Head Gasket?

A single-layer steel gasket consists of one steel sheet that provides a durable and flexible seal. It is typically used in older engine designs or in applications where the engine operates under moderate conditions. The single layer offers good conformability to the engine surfaces, ensuring a reliable seal. However, it may be less tolerant to engine expansion and high-pressure conditions compared to multi-layer designs.

What Is a Multi-Layer Steel (MLS) Head Gasket?

Multi-layer steel gaskets are composed of several thin steel layers, usually between three and five, which are bonded together. This construction provides enhanced strength, flexibility, and durability. MLS gaskets are designed to handle higher pressures and temperatures, making them ideal for modern engines, especially those with turbochargers or high-performance specifications. Their multilayer design allows for better sealing under thermal expansion and engine movement.

Key Differences Between SLS and MLS Gaskets

  • Material Composition: SLS has one steel layer, while MLS has multiple layers bonded together.
  • Durability: MLS gaskets generally last longer and withstand higher pressures.
  • Application: SLS is suitable for older or less demanding engines; MLS is preferred for modern, high-performance engines.
  • Cost: MLS gaskets tend to be more expensive due to their complex construction.
  • Sealing Performance: MLS offers superior sealing under thermal expansion and high pressure conditions.

Choosing the Right Gasket for Your Engine

When selecting a head gasket, consider your engine’s specifications and operating conditions. For older engines or those with moderate performance requirements, a single-layer steel gasket may suffice. However, for modern engines with higher pressures, temperatures, or turbocharging, a multi-layer steel gasket provides better reliability and longevity.
